About Daniela Bouvet
Daniela Bouvet is a scholar working on Plant Science, Molecular Biology, Civil and Structural Engineering,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ics and Ecology, having authored 7 papers that have together received 27 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Mediterranean and Iberian flora and fauna (4 papers), Botany and Plant Ecology Studies (3 papers),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(2 papers), Plant and animal studies (1 paper), Infrastructure Maintenance and Monitoring (1 paper), Urban Planning and Landscape Design (1 paper), Botany, Ecology, and Taxonomy Studies (1 paper) and Plant and Fungal Species Descriptions (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ics (12 citations), Forestry (2 citations), Plant Science (15 citations),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(3 citations) and Environmental Engineering (3 citations). Daniela Bouvet has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, Italy and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Edoardo Martinetto, Pedro Jiménez‐Mejías, P.A. Magni, Fabio Conti, A. Tilia, Guillermo López García, Fabrizio Bartolucci, Laura Cancellieri, David Bétaille and Romeo Di Pietro. Their work appears in journals such as Review of Palaeobotany and Palynology, annales de biologie animale biochimie biophysique,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, SPIRE - Sciences Po Institutional REpository and PORTO Publications Open Repository TOrino (Politecnico di Torino).
